View Product DetailsVerdict
Overall, the iFi Hip-dac receives high praise for its sound quality, portability, and features such as the XBass boost and balanced output. It is noted to be a significant improvement over built-in device audio and other portable DAC-amps. However, there are some minor complaints about the lack of a power supply and compatibility with certain devices. The majority of reviewers highly recommend the iFi Hip-dac for headphone listening, with some even considering it an endgame device.
Verdict
The Darkglass Element Cabinet Simulation is a versatile and highly recommended tool for musicians looking for a headphone amp and cab sim. It offers built-in EQ, cab sim, and Bluetooth connectivity for playing along with tracks. Many users appreciate its ability to provide a great sound for silent practice, and it can also be used as a DI for live performances. While some users have had issues with Bluetooth connectivity, overall the Darkglass Element is praised for its quality and convenience.
